TypeDeclaration parentDecl = findType((IType)parent); if (parentDecl == null) return null; types = parentDecl.memberTypes; FieldDeclaration fieldDecl = findField((IField)parent); if (fieldDecl == null) return null; Visitor visitor = new Visitor(); return visitor.result; case IJavaElement.INITIALIZER: Initializer initializer = findInitializer((IInitializer)parent); if (initializer == null) return null; visitor = new Visitor(); return visitor.result; case IJavaElement.METHOD: AbstractMethodDeclaration methodDecl = findMethod((IMethod)parent); if (methodDecl == null) return null; visitor = new Visitor();
CompilationUnitDeclaration parsedUnit = buildBindings(unit, isTopLevelOrMember); if (parsedUnit != null) { TypeDeclaration typeDecl = new ASTNodeFinder(parsedUnit).findType(this.type); if (typeDecl != null && typeDecl.binding != null) collectSuperTypeNames(typeDecl.binding, null);
public Initializer findInitializer(IInitializer initializerHandle) { TypeDeclaration typeDecl = findType((IType)initializerHandle.getParent()); if (typeDecl == null) return null; FieldDeclaration[] fields = typeDecl.fields; if (fields != null) { int occurenceCount = ((SourceRefElement)initializerHandle).occurrenceCount; for (int i = 0, length = fields.length; i < length; i++) { FieldDeclaration field = fields[i]; if (field instanceof Initializer && --occurenceCount == 0) { return (Initializer)field; } } } return null; }
CompilationUnitDeclaration unit = skope.referenceCompilationUnit(); if (unit != null) { AbstractMethodDeclaration amd = new ASTNodeFinder(unit).findMethod((IMethod) methodPattern.focus); if (amd != null && amd.binding != null && amd.binding.isValidBinding()) { this.bindings.put(methodPattern, amd.binding);
CompilationUnitDeclaration parsedUnit = buildBindings(unit, isTopLevelOrMember); if (parsedUnit != null) { TypeDeclaration typeDecl = new ASTNodeFinder(parsedUnit).findType(this.type); if (typeDecl != null && typeDecl.binding != null) collectSuperTypeNames(typeDecl.binding, null);
public Initializer findInitializer(IInitializer initializerHandle) { TypeDeclaration typeDecl = findType((IType)initializerHandle.getParent()); if (typeDecl == null) return null; FieldDeclaration[] fields = typeDecl.fields; if (fields != null) { int occurenceCount = ((SourceRefElement)initializerHandle).occurrenceCount; for (int i = 0, length = fields.length; i < length; i++) { FieldDeclaration field = fields[i]; if (field instanceof Initializer && --occurenceCount == 0) { return (Initializer)field; } } } return null; }
CompilationUnitDeclaration unit = skope.referenceCompilationUnit(); if (unit != null) { AbstractMethodDeclaration amd = new ASTNodeFinder(unit).findMethod((IMethod) methodPattern.focus); if (amd != null && amd.binding != null && amd.binding.isValidBinding()) { this.bindings.put(methodPattern, amd.binding);
TypeDeclaration parentDecl = findType((IType)parent); if (parentDecl == null) return null; types = parentDecl.memberTypes; FieldDeclaration fieldDecl = findField((IField)parent); if (fieldDecl == null) return null; Visitor visitor = new Visitor(); return visitor.result; case IJavaElement.INITIALIZER: Initializer initializer = findInitializer((IInitializer)parent); if (initializer == null) return null; visitor = new Visitor(); return visitor.result; case IJavaElement.METHOD: AbstractMethodDeclaration methodDecl = findMethod((IMethod)parent); if (methodDecl == null) return null; visitor = new Visitor();
CompilationUnitDeclaration parsedUnit = buildBindings(unit, isTopLevelOrMember); if (parsedUnit != null) { TypeDeclaration typeDecl = new ASTNodeFinder(parsedUnit).findType(this.type); if (typeDecl != null && typeDecl.binding != null) collectSuperTypeNames(typeDecl.binding);
public Initializer findInitializer(IInitializer initializerHandle) { TypeDeclaration typeDecl = findType((IType)initializerHandle.getParent()); if (typeDecl == null) return null; FieldDeclaration[] fields = typeDecl.fields; if (fields != null) { int occurenceCount = ((SourceRefElement)initializerHandle).occurrenceCount; for (int i = 0, length = fields.length; i < length; i++) { FieldDeclaration field = fields[i]; if (field instanceof Initializer && --occurenceCount == 0) { return (Initializer)field; } } } return null; }
CompilationUnitDeclaration unit = skope.referenceCompilationUnit(); if (unit != null) { AbstractMethodDeclaration amd = new ASTNodeFinder(unit).findMethod((IMethod) methodPattern.focus); if (amd != null && amd.binding != null && amd.binding.isValidBinding()) { this.bindings.put(methodPattern, amd.binding);
TypeDeclaration parentDecl = findType((IType)parent); if (parentDecl == null) return null; types = parentDecl.memberTypes; FieldDeclaration fieldDecl = findField((IField)parent); if (fieldDecl == null) return null; Visitor visitor = new Visitor(); return visitor.result; case IJavaElement.INITIALIZER: Initializer initializer = findInitializer((IInitializer)parent); if (initializer == null) return null; visitor = new Visitor(); return visitor.result; case IJavaElement.METHOD: AbstractMethodDeclaration methodDecl = findMethod((IMethod)parent); if (methodDecl == null) return null; visitor = new Visitor();
CompilationUnitDeclaration parsedUnit = buildBindings(unit, isTopLevelOrMember); if (parsedUnit != null) { TypeDeclaration typeDecl = new ASTNodeFinder(parsedUnit).findType(this.type); if (typeDecl != null && typeDecl.binding != null) collectSuperTypeNames(typeDecl.binding, null);
public Initializer findInitializer(IInitializer initializerHandle) { TypeDeclaration typeDecl = findType((IType)initializerHandle.getParent()); if (typeDecl == null) return null; FieldDeclaration[] fields = typeDecl.fields; if (fields != null) { int occurenceCount = ((SourceRefElement)initializerHandle).occurrenceCount; for (int i = 0, length = fields.length; i < length; i++) { FieldDeclaration field = fields[i]; if (field instanceof Initializer && --occurenceCount == 0) { return (Initializer)field; } } } return null; }
CompilationUnitDeclaration unit = skope.referenceCompilationUnit(); if (unit != null) { AbstractMethodDeclaration amd = new ASTNodeFinder(unit).findMethod((IMethod) methodPattern.focus); if (amd != null && amd.binding != null && amd.binding.isValidBinding()) { this.bindings.put(methodPattern, amd.binding);
TypeDeclaration parentDecl = findType((IType)parent); if (parentDecl == null) return null; types = parentDecl.memberTypes; FieldDeclaration fieldDecl = findField((IField)parent); if (fieldDecl == null) return null; Visitor visitor = new Visitor(); return visitor.result; case IJavaElement.INITIALIZER: Initializer initializer = findInitializer((IInitializer)parent); if (initializer == null) return null; visitor = new Visitor(); return visitor.result; case IJavaElement.METHOD: AbstractMethodDeclaration methodDecl = findMethod((IMethod)parent); if (methodDecl == null) return null; visitor = new Visitor();
CompilationUnitDeclaration parsedUnit = buildBindings(unit, isTopLevelOrMember); if (parsedUnit != null) { TypeDeclaration typeDecl = new ASTNodeFinder(parsedUnit).findType(this.type); if (typeDecl != null && typeDecl.binding != null) collectSuperTypeNames(typeDecl.binding, null);
public Initializer findInitializer(IInitializer initializerHandle) { TypeDeclaration typeDecl = findType((IType)initializerHandle.getParent()); if (typeDecl == null) return null; FieldDeclaration[] fields = typeDecl.fields; if (fields != null) { int occurenceCount = ((SourceRefElement)initializerHandle).occurrenceCount; for (int i = 0, length = fields.length; i < length; i++) { FieldDeclaration field = fields[i]; if (field instanceof Initializer && --occurenceCount == 0) { return (Initializer)field; } } } return null; }
CompilationUnitDeclaration unit = skope.referenceCompilationUnit(); if (unit != null) { AbstractMethodDeclaration amd = new ASTNodeFinder(unit).findMethod((IMethod) methodPattern.focus); if (amd != null && amd.binding != null && amd.binding.isValidBinding()) { this.bindings.put(methodPattern, amd.binding);
TypeDeclaration parentDecl = findType((IType)parent); if (parentDecl == null) return null; types = parentDecl.memberTypes; FieldDeclaration fieldDecl = findField((IField)parent); if (fieldDecl == null) return null; Visitor visitor = new Visitor(); return visitor.result; case IJavaElement.INITIALIZER: Initializer initializer = findInitializer((IInitializer)parent); if (initializer == null) return null; visitor = new Visitor(); return visitor.result; case IJavaElement.METHOD: AbstractMethodDeclaration methodDecl = findMethod((IMethod)parent); if (methodDecl == null) return null; visitor = new Visitor();